Home Ministry grants permission for opening of 3000 CBSE affiliated schools as assessment centres across India to evaluate CBSE Board exams answers sheets

Home Ministry today granted permission for opening of 3000 CBSE affiliated schools as assessment centres across India to facilitate evaluation of answer sheets of CBSE Board exams. Union Minister for HRD Ramesh Pokhriyal ‘Nishank’ expressed his gratitude towards the Ministry of Home Affairs for giving the permission. He said that 3000 CBSE affiliated schools have been identified as assessment centers across India and special permission will be granted to these schools for the limited purpose of evaluation.

Nishank hoped that this will help us to quickly evaluate the 1.5 crore answer sheets. The results will be declared after the remaining board examinations have been conducted (scheduled between July 1 and 15, 2020).
